Author Chinn, Sarah E.

Title Technology and the logic of American racism : a cultural history of the body as evidence / Sarah E. Chinn.

Publication Info. London ; New York : Continuum, 2000.

Item Status

Location Call No. Status OPAC Message Public Note Gift Note
 Moore Stacks  E185.61 .C56 2000    Available  ---
Description xvii, 233 pages ; 25 cm.
Series Critical research in material culture
Critical research in material culture.
Bibliography Includes bibliographical references (pages 207-225) and index.
Contents Theorizing the body as evidence -- A show of hands: establishing identity in Mark Twain's The tragedy of Pudd'nhead Wilson -- Fixing identity: reading skin, seeing race -- "Liberty's life stream": blood, race, and citizenship in World War II -- Reading the "book of life": DNA and the meanings of identity -- Epilogue: future bodies, present selves.
